Hastings-on-Hudson UFSD VACANCY 2025 - 2026
ASSISTANT SUPERINTENDENT PUPIL PERSONNEL SERVICES
Requirements
- A minimum of five years of administrative experience in special education.
- Proven experience in the areas of social work, psychology, speech and language, English as a New Language, guidance and/or related areas.
- Proven experience developing and implementing strategic plans for PPS.
- Possess leadership attributes as stated in the Portrait of a Hastings Learner: Bold, Collaborative, Empathetic, Empowered, Inquisitive and Inventive.
- Comprehensive knowledge of federal and State legal requirements governing special education, ENL, and homelessness.
- Experience with federal grants, State grants, and reporting requirements.
- Comprehensive knowledge of instructional best practices and structures that support student learning, especially as they apply to special education and ENL curriculum, programs, practices, and related services.
- Experience using data and evidence to establish clear and measurable goals to monitor students’ progress and evaluate instructional programs.
- Expertise in the hiring, supervision, and evaluation of faculty and staff to promote professional growth and ensure high standards of professional accountability in diverse educational settings.
- Expertise as an instructional leader, capable of serving as a lead professional developer for a diverse and talented student services faculty.
- Ability to collaborate with stakeholders and community agencies, including students, parents, faculty and administration, CPSE agencies, BOCES administrators, private and residential schools, the courts, and other school districts in a shared commitment to the goals of the district and improving services to students.
- Proven experience developing and managing district-wide budgets under PPS.
- Comprehensive experience chairing CSE, CPSE, and 504 meetings.
- Extensive experience developing IEP and 504 plans.
- Proven experience in impartial hearings and the mediation/resolution process as required.
- Experience with implementing the Culturally Responsive Sustaining and Educational Framework (NYSED).
- Bilingual language skills (Spanish or other) a plus.
- New York State Administrative Certification: SDL or SDA required.
Twelve-month Tenure Track position, reporting to the Superintendent of Schools. Position start date: August 1, 2025. Salary range: $180,000-$210,000.
